.product-form__sample-request{margin-top:1.2rem}.product-form__sample-request .sample-request-toggle{width:100%;justify-content:center}.sample-request-nav{position:relative;display:inline-flex;align-items:center;text-decoration:none;color:inherit}.sample-request-nav__icon{position:relative;width:2.2rem;height:2.2rem}.sample-request-nav__icon svg{width:100%;height:100%;transition:transform .2s ease}.sample-request-nav__count{position:absolute;bottom:.35rem;left:2.2rem;background-color:#bc923f;color:#fff;height:1.7rem;width:1.7rem;border-radius:100%;display:flex;justify-content:center;align-items:center;font-size:.9rem;line-height:calc(1 + .1 / var(--font-body-scale))}.sample-request-nav__count--empty{background-color:#d1d1d1;color:#666}.sample-request-toggle{display:inline-flex;align-items:center;justify-content:center;gap:.8rem;border:1px solid rgba(var(--color-foreground),.2)!important;background:transparent!important}.sample-request-toggle:hover{border-color:rgb(var(--color-foreground))!important}.sample-request-toggle__icon{width:1.6rem;height:1.8rem;display:flex;align-items:center;justify-content:center}.sample-request-toggle__icon svg{width:100%;height:100%}.sample-request-toggle__icon svg path{stroke:currentColor;fill:none;transition:fill .2s ease}.sample-request-toggle.is-active{background:#bc923f!important;border-color:#bc923f!important;color:#fff!important}.sample-request-toggle.is-active .sample-request-toggle__icon svg path{stroke:#fff;fill:#fff}.sample-request-page__items{margin-bottom:2rem}.sample-request-item{display:flex;align-items:center;padding:1.6rem 0;gap:1.6rem;border-bottom:.1rem solid rgba(var(--color-foreground),.1)}.sample-request-item:last-child{border-bottom:none}.sample-request-item__number{font-size:1.6rem;font-weight:700;color:rgba(var(--color-foreground),.4);width:2.4rem;text-align:center;flex-shrink:0}.sample-request-item__image{width:8rem;height:8rem;flex-shrink:0;border-radius:.4rem;overflow:hidden;background:rgba(var(--color-foreground),.05)}.sample-request-item__image a{display:block;width:100%;height:100%}.sample-request-item__image img{width:100%;height:100%;object-fit:cover}.sample-request-item__details{flex:1;min-width:0}.sample-request-item__title{font-size:1.5rem;font-weight:600;margin:0 0 .4rem;line-height:1.3}.sample-request-item__title a{text-decoration:none;color:inherit}.sample-request-item__title a:hover{color:rgb(var(--color-button))}.sample-request-item__actions{flex-shrink:0}.sample-request-item__remove{background:none;border:.1rem solid rgba(var(--color-foreground),.2);cursor:pointer;padding:.8rem;border-radius:.4rem;color:rgba(var(--color-foreground),.6);transition:all .2s ease;display:flex;align-items:center;justify-content:center}.sample-request-item__remove:hover{border-color:#c00;color:#c00;background:#cc00000d}.sample-request-item__remove svg{width:1.2rem;height:1.2rem}.sample-request-notification{position:fixed;bottom:2rem;right:2rem;background:rgb(var(--color-foreground));color:rgb(var(--color-background));padding:1.4rem 2.4rem;border-radius:.4rem;transform:translateY(100px);opacity:0;transition:all .3s ease;z-index:99999;font-size:1.4rem;max-width:30rem}.sample-request-notification.is-visible{transform:translateY(0);opacity:1}#SampleRequestForm select.field__input{padding-top:2.2rem;line-height:1em}@media (max-width: 749px){.sample-request-item{flex-wrap:wrap}.sample-request-item__number{display:none}.sample-request-item__image{width:6rem;height:6rem}.sample-request-item__details{flex:1;min-width:calc(100% - 10rem)}}
/*# sourceMappingURL=/cdn/shop/t/119/assets/sample-request.css.map */
